How to find us by rail

Cardiff Central is the main station in the city and is approximately 15 minutes walk from the office through the city centre. The closest station is Cathays, a short 2 minute walk from the office. If travelling to Cathays station, you will need to change trains at Cardiff Central and use any number of regular local valley lines trains that stop at Cathays. Upon alighting the train, you will walk on to Park Place and bear left walking past the Cardiff University Centre for Student Life. Continue along Park Place until you see our office on your left before the junction with Museum Place.

Car parks

There is on street parking outside the office on Park Place and along Museum Place, payable using the roadside machines via debit/credit card or via MiPermit. There are also 2 roadside Osprey EV charging points immediately outside the office on Park Place.

There are a number of city centre car parks a short walk from our office, however the closest car park is –

NCP Dumfries Place (7 minutes walk to the office) - CF10 3FN

Park and ride

You can park at County Hall car park for free on weekends and bank holidays (except on major event days) and catch the number 6 Cardiff Bus service from Hemmingway Road bus stop into Cardiff city centre.

You can pay the driver on the bus or use the Cardiff Bus App.

You can also reach Cardiff bay or the city centre by walking or using an Ovo bike available from outside the County hall main entrance.

The sat nav reference for this site is CF10 4UW.
